How are the reactions of photosynthesis and respiration similar?

Both photosynthesis and respiration involve the conversion of energy from one form to another through a series of biochemical reactions. Both processes use and produce ATP in reactions that are carried out on membranes and are controlled by enzymes.

What is the equation for cellular respiration using chemical formulas?

The equation for cellular respiration is: C6H12O6 + 6O2 → 6CO2 + 6H20 + energy (Glucose + Oxygen yields Carbon Dioxide + Water + Energy) You may notice that the equation for cellular respiration is the opposite of the equation for photosynthesis.

What relationship are respiration and photosynthesis reciprocal?

The reactions of respiration take sugar and consume oxygen to break it down into carbon dioxide and water, releasing energy. Thus, the reactants of photosynthesis are the products of respiration, and vice versa.

  • What equation best represents the process of photosynthesis?

    Which of the following equation can be more appropriate for photosynthesis? The process of photosynthesis is commonly written as: 6CO 2 + 6H 2 O → C 6 H 12 O 6 + 6O 2 . This means that the reactants, six carbon dioxide molecules and six water molecules, are converted by light energy captured by chlorophyll (implied by the arrow) into a sugar molecule and six oxygen molecules, the products.

  • What is the complete equation of respiration?

    The word equation for cellular respiration is glucose (sugar) + oxygen = carbon dioxide + water + energy (as ATP). The balanced chemical equation for this reaction is C6H1206 + 6O2 = 6CO2 + 6H2O + energy (ATP). However, cellular or aerobic respiration takes place in stages, including glycolysis and the Kreb’s cycle.
